Cultural institution (unnamed)
A cultural NFT platform
High-fidelity digitisation, curated minting and rights-aware metadata, so a collection's provenance survives outside the institution that holds it.
Scope & intent: high-fidelity digitization, curated minting, rights-aware metadata and institution-grade marketplace flows.
- Digital twin creation: 3D scanning + ultra-HD imaging as canonical media payloads; content hashed and referenced from on-chain metadata.
- Provenance envelope (“Artist’s Footprint”): structured metadata (licence, exhibition record, signatures, chain of custody) embedded in JSON-LD and IPFS/Filecoin anchors.
- Access & monetization: gated minting (curator/artist roles), primary sale rules, automatic royalty routing (EIP-2981 style), and unlockable content for owners.
- Relevant technical choices: ERC-721 / ERC-1155 token models, IPFS + Filecoin for media, modular marketplace contracts inspired by Seaport.
Why it matters: embeds institutional provenance into token metadata so cultural institutions can control licensing, demonstrate chain-of-custody, and create durable digital assets that link to physical collections.
